Advantages of 2D Boron Nanosheets Over Other 2D Nanomaterials

摘要

Two-dimensional (2D) nanomaterials, including graphene (Gr), have attracted significant interest for a variety of applications, such as biomedicine, energy harvesting/storage, sensing, and catalysis. The high mechanical stiffness, excellent electrical conductivity, optical transparency, and biocompatibility have led to their rapid advances. In addition to Gr, other 2D nanomaterials, such as boron (B) and their derivatives, including 2D-boron nanosheets (2D-BNSs), have shown better physical, electrical, and mechanical properties with high in-plane stiffness, strength, and flexibility. This chapter focuses on the physical, electrical, optical, and mechanical properties, the structural advantages of 2D boron nanosheets, and their derivatives compared to other 2D materials.
